The cortical visual area V6 in macaque and human brains.

Single cell recording and neuro-anatomical techniques in the monkey have allowed to find a mosaic of visual areas in the temporo-parieto-occipital cortex. Thanks to neuroimaging methods, several of these areas have been mapped also in the human brain and named in humans based on homologies in their visuotopic organization with non-human primate areas. Sensitivity of human visual cortical area V6 to stereoscopic depth gradients associated with self-motion

The principal visual cue to self-motion (egomotion) is optic flow, which is specified in terms of local 2D velocities in the retinal image without reference to depth cues. However, in general, points near the center of expansion of natural flow fields are distant, whereas those in the periphery are closer, creating gradients of horizontal binocular disparity. The cortical connections of area V6: an occipito-parietal network processing visual information.

The aim of this work was to study the cortical connections of area V6 by injecting neuronal tracers into different retinotopic representations of this area. To this purpose, we first functionally recognized V6 by recording from neurons of the parieto-occipital cortex in awake macaque monkeys. Human V6: The Medial Motion Area

Cortical-surface-based functional Magnetic Resonance Imaging mapping techniques and wide-field retinotopic stimulation were used to verify the presence of pattern motion sensitivity in human area V6. Area V6 is highly selective for coherently moving fields of dots, both at individual and group levels and even with a visual stimulus of standard size.
